The Flyers will face the Capitals in their second to last game before the 4 Nations break.

Washington can win the season series with a victory. They’ve outscored Philadelphia 10-4 in the two games played thus far. The two haven’t seen each other since October, though, so a lot has changed on both sides.

Philadelphia Flyers

The Flyers finally scored a goal in their last game, avoiding a new franchise-record scoreless streak. The goal came from Rodrigo Abols, his first in the NHL. However, that wasn’t enough to break Philadelphia’s losing streak. They’ve now lost four straight and six of their last seven.

They continue to have a depleted lineup as none of their injured players will be available. They’ve still been unable to get Andrei Kuzmenko and Jakob Pelletier on board. Kuzmenko’s visa situation was handled, but his flight from Toronto was delayed due to the weather. The hope is now to have them both available for Saturday’s game.

After Sam Ersson put up what John Tortorella called his best performance of the season, it will be Ivan Fedotov’s turn to try and put up his best efforts. He has lost his last six starts, but his most recent games have not been poor outings. He could use a win, though.

Washington Capitals

The Capitals have continued to surprise as they are first in the Metro and second in the entire league with 77 points. They have points in four straight games, two of those being overtime losses. One of the most surprising things is that Washington has not lost more than two in a row this entire season.

Alex Ovechkin continues to defy the odds as he works toward breaking Wayne Gretzky’s record for career goals. Ovechkin, leading the Capitals with 25 goals, sits 17 goals away from history. He can’t get them all in one game, but he does have 50 career goals in 76 games against Philadelphia.

Charlie Lindgren and Logan Thompson have formed an admirable duo for the Capitals. It’ll be the former in the net against the Flyers. He gave up one goal in the matchup on Oct. 22. On the season, Lindgren has a 2.61 GAA and a .903 SV%.
